id=\"What_is_cruising_altitude_for_a_commercial_airplane\"><\/span><b>What is cruising altitude for a commercial airplane?<\/b><span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>The cruising altitude for a commercial airplane usually ranges between 30,000 and 40,000 feet, which is approximately 5.7 to 7.6 miles above sea level. This altitude is chosen to ensure overall safety, fuel efficiency, and passenger comfort during long-haul flights.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"What_factors_determine_the_cruising_altitude\"><\/span>What factors determine the cruising altitude?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>Several factors determine the selection of a specific cruising altitude for a commercial airplane. These include the aircraft type, weight, prevailing weather conditions, air traffic congestion, and airspace regulations enforced by aviation authorities.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"Why_is_the_cruising_altitude_so_high\"><\/span>Why is the cruising altitude so high?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>Commercial airplanes cruise at high altitudes primarily for two reasons: fuel efficiency and safety. Flying at a higher altitude reduces drag caused by air resistance, enabling the aircraft to achieve better fuel economy. Moreover, being at an increased distance from potential obstacles on the ground enhances safety in the event of an emergency.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"How_do_pilots_determine_the_cruising_altitude\"><\/span>How do pilots determine the cruising altitude?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>Pilots determine the cruising altitude based on factors such as the planned route, weather conditions, air traffic control instructions, and the aircraft&#8217;s performance capabilities. They aim to reach the most optimal altitude that ensures safety, saves fuel, and delivers a smooth flying experience.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"Are_there_different_cruising_altitudes_for_different_types_of_airplanes\"><\/span>Are there different cruising altitudes for different types of airplanes?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>Yes, different types of airplanes may have varying cruising altitudes based on their design and capabilities. Larger commercial jets, such as Boeing 747s or Airbus A380s, can fly at higher altitudes due to their advanced engines and aerodynamics, while smaller regional aircraft may operate at lower altitudes.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"What_are_the_advantages_of_flying_at_higher_cruising_altitudes\"><\/span>What are the advantages of flying at higher cruising altitudes?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>Flying at higher cruising altitudes offers several advantages. It reduces air traffic congestion, minimizes the risk of turbulence, allows for faster ground speed, enhances radio and radar communication, and provides a more comfortable journey for passengers.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"Can_commercial_airplanes_fly_above_their_cruising_altitude\"><\/span>Can commercial airplanes fly above their cruising altitude?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>In certain situations, commercial airplanes can be authorized to fly above their designated cruising altitude. This may occur when avoiding severe turbulence, accommodating air traffic control instructions, or optimizing fuel consumption by utilizing higher tailwinds.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"Does_the_cruising_altitude_change_during_the_flight\"><\/span>Does the cruising altitude change during the flight?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>The cruising altitude can change during a flight depending on various factors. Pilots may request altitude changes to avoid turbulent weather, optimize fuel consumption, adjust to air traffic conditions, or comply with air traffic control instructions.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"Does_the_cruising_altitude_affect_cabin_pressure\"><\/span>Does the cruising altitude affect cabin pressure?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>The cruising altitude does have an impact on cabin pressure. However, modern commercial airplanes are equipped with pressurization systems that maintain cabin pressure at a comfortable level regardless of the cruising altitude, ensuring passenger well-being during the flight.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"Are_there_any_restrictions_on_cruising_altitudes\"><\/span>Are there any restrictions on cruising altitudes?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>Yes, aviation authorities impose certain restrictions on cruising altitudes to ensure air traffic separation and safety. Additionally, specific airspace areas near airports, military zones, or restricted airspace have their own defined cruising altitudes to maintain order and security.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"What_happens_if_an_airplane_loses_cabin_pressure_at_cruising_altitude\"><\/span>What happens if an airplane loses cabin pressure at cruising altitude?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>If an airplane were to experience a loss of cabin pressure at cruising altitude, the pilots would initiate emergency procedures. The aircraft would rapidly descend to a lower altitude where the oxygen level is sufficient for passengers and crew to breathe normally.<\/p>\n<h3><span class=\"ez-toc-section\" id=\"Can_passengers_feel_the_difference_in_cruising_altitudes\"><\/span>Can passengers feel the difference in cruising altitudes?<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>Passengers generally do not feel the difference in cruising altitudes since modern airplanes are highly stable and equipped with advanced technology to ensure a smooth flight. However, they may occasionally notice a change in altitude during ascent or descent, typically during takeoff and landing.<\/p>\n<p>In conclusion, the cruising altitude for a commercial airplane typically ranges between 30,000 and 40,000 feet. It is a carefully selected altitude that optimizes fuel efficiency, ensures safety, and provides a comfortable flying experience for passengers.
